IMPDP - loading data import process in the SYSTEM. ERR$ DPnnnnnnnn - is - this?

Environment:


Oracle 11.2.0.3 EE on Solaris


When you run a data pump import in an existing schema, the process is stopped with:


ORA-39171: job knows a wait can be resumed.

ORA-01653: unable to extend the SYSTEM table. ERR$ DP010704470001 by 8192 in the SYSTEM tablespace

I searched this error message in the documentation and the web and MOS, but so far, came the voids.


I know that the input data have some inside LOB columns, but I loaded previously in other schemas in the database.


This entry dumpfile is a bit bigger than the previous ones, but I didn't think that would matter.


The SYSTEM tablespace has currently 4 GB allocated that is obviously much larger than normally necessary.


I tried to import metadata only, disabling all triggers because I thought they were the cause of the problem, and then loading the data, but the result was the same.


Any help is greatly appreciated!


-gary

Hi Gary,.

It's just a simple case of the execution of the SYSTEM tablespace out of room by the look of it - you must be

(1) add more space

(2) stop task and re - run as another user who does not have the default tablespace of the system

I'm not 100% sure what the table is that datapump creates (it is not the normal main table which is quite small) but I think it's probably to be created (and full) If you use the skip_constrant_errors parameter that records all lines that could not be loaded because of violations of constraints - if it is a large amount of data, omitting the table would get large enough.

    This is what worked for me to get the ability to print in Ubuntu 14.04. These aren't the most extensive instructions, I'm tired, so I apologize. I hope this will help you get started, please keep in mind that I am no expert so follow at your own risk. This assumes that you have already installed cups (it comes pre-installed with most distributions).

    Includes the following: download the Unified Driver Dell, moving some files and adding the printer via application printers of Ubuntu.

    1. download the universal driver of Dell on the link in my first post and unzip the files (in Ubuntu, you could double-click on and click on extract), which should give you a folder named cdroot, I will refer to this folder across.

    DO NOT run the installation script. As mentioned above, it's disastrous things, and judging by the response of Dell to this post (none), they are able to send email to a person who cares little interest.

    2. I had started going to the printers Ubuntu app, and he told me that it won't work without 'rastertospl' being installed. If you have a 32-bit installation, this file is located in cdroot/Linux/x86_64 if you have a 64-bit installation and cdroot/Linux/i386. You need to copy in/usr/lib/cups/filter and make sure it is executable, and sudo privileges are required to do. Claiming that you have extracted the Dell installation package to your desktop, orders of the terminal would be these for a 64-bit system:

    sudo cp ~/Desktop/cdroot/Linux/x86_64/rastertospl/usr/lib/cups/filter

    (Check if it is already executable, then tell - rwxr-xr-x to the left after you run the following command. Note the s in 'x'):

    ls-l/usr/lib/cups/filter | grep rastertospl
     
    If there are not three x as described above, run this:

    sudo chmod + x/usr/lib/cups/filter/rastertospl

    After you run the program rastertospl (thanks to Olivier at the second link below for the tip), the program shows that we need the libscmssc.so library. He finds himself cdroot/Linux/x86_64 or cdroot/Linux/i386. To copy in the file/usr/lib and again make sure it is executable:

    sudo cp ~/Desktop/cdroot/Linux/x86_64/libscmss.so/usr/lib
    (if needed :))
    sudo chmod + x /usr/lib/libscmss.so

    3. I went to app printers of Ubuntu in the settings (System settings > printers) and click Add.

    (I had already configured the printer on my network, so I was able to search for and select, if all goes well it shows for you.) When the drivers could not be found for the printer (do not take the generic, it won't work), it gives you an option to add a PPD file. The b1165nfw.ppd file is in cdroot/Linux/noarch/at_opt/share/PPD. I sailed from the app to printers.

    After that, the impression has worked for me. It does not scan. Who will have to wait another day.

    Reset the DNS and TCP/IP settings.

    1. Press the Windows key + X, click prompt (Admin).
    2. Please enter the following commands and press ENTER after each one.

      netsh int ip reset resetlog.txt
      netsh winsock reset
      ipconfig/registerdns
      ipconfig/flushdns
      ipconfig/release

    3. Restart the computer to check the issue.
